Novroz signals the start of spring

(eTN) - Novroz is celebrated in Central Asia, South Asia, and Eastern Europe – Novroz is a Persian word meaning "New Day" and was celebrated all over Central Asia yesterday, and in some parts of eas

A festival of the unusual kind at Chichén Itzá

Upon the arrival of the Equinox (March 20, 21 and September 21, 22) thousands flock to the Yucatán peninsula of México to witness an amazing phenomenon – the sun's rays project a diamond-back ratt